Output 507588d9301d27fd3db8e0ff2f76bd22cec2c94b458bc2e006312d956d9cbe6c:0

value
20547392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c25f8567178ba7c286fe50e22d9b89fd066b5357 OP_EQUAL
address
3KQmSgUwSdmohpVWodEWJzY8rw46N7TuZx
transaction
507588d9301d27fd3db8e0ff2f76bd22cec2c94b458bc2e006312d956d9cbe6c
spent
true